| 4D v13PV Creer zone hors ecran |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| 
 | 
    4D View v13
 PV Creer zone hors ecran 
         | |||||||||||||||||||||||||||||||||||||||||||||||||||||||
| PV Creer zone hors ecran -> Résultat | ||||||||
| Paramètre | Type | Description | ||||||
| Résultat | Entier long |   | Zone 4D PowerView | |||||
La commande PV Creer zone hors ecran crée une zone 4D View en mémoire et retourne sa référence. Cette dernière devra être passée à toute commande 4D View destinée à agir sur cette zone.
Une fois que vous n’en avez plus l'utilité, n’oubliez pas de détruire cette zone à l’aide de la commande PV SUPPRIMER ZONE HORS ECRAN de manière à libérer la place qu'elle occupe en mémoire.
Cette méthode permet de copier le contenu d’un modèle pour le coller dans une zone à l’écran :
 C_ENTIER LONG($ZoneHorsEcran) `Référence de la zone hors écran
 
 CHERCHER([Modèles];[Modèles]NomModèle="MonModèle") `Recherche du modèle désiré
 $ZoneHorsEcran:=PV Creer zone hors ecran `Création de la zone hors écran
  `Récupération du modèle
 PV BLOB VERS ZONE($ZoneHorsEcran;[Modèles]ChampBlob_)
 PV SELECTIONNER PLAGE($ZoneHorsEcran;1;1;3;3;pv sélection définir)
 PV EXECUTER COMMANDE($ZoneHorsEcran;pv cmd édition copier) `Copie de la sélection
 PV SUPPRIMER ZONE HORS ECRAN($ZoneHorsEcran) `Libération mémoire
 PV ALLER A CELLULE(Zone;1;5)
 PV EXECUTER COMMANDE(Zone;pv cmd édition coller) `Collage de la sélection dans la zone active
	Produit :  4D
	Thème :  PV Zone
	Numéro :  
        15998
        
        
        
	Nom intl. :  PV New offscreen area
     Liste alphabétique des commandes
    Liste alphabétique des commandes
	Créé :  4D View 6.8
PV BLOB VERS ZONE
PV SUPPRIMER ZONE HORS ECRAN